My Brother’s a Genius

By Debris Stevenson

Poetry, grime and dance unite in this explosive new play about learning to fall, fail and find our own ways to fly.

My Brother’s a Genius by Debris Stevenson will tour to UK schools and theatres in Spring 2026, in a major new co-production with Sheffield Theatres and National Youth Theatre.

Daisy and Luke are twins navigating life in a high-rise estate, where ambition and self-doubt collide. Both twins have labels thrust upon them: Daisy the “idiot” and Luke the “genius”. But will their bond and shared dream of flying launch them up together or crash them apart?

Based on conversations with young people across the UK and written by Debris Stevenson (Poet in da Corner, Royal Court), My Brother’s a Genius combines poetry, grime and dance to explore neurodiversity, sibling rivalry, and the weight of expectations.

Debris Stevenson is our current Resident Writer. Over the next year, My Brother’s a Genius will be developed through conversations with young people in schools and community groups across the nation through our Future Makers process.

A dyslexic writer, Grime poet, hybrid-actor and pro-raver, Debris Stevenson’s work explores the intersectional, unexpected, and unjust – often whilst making her audiences dance, question, and laugh.

The Production

The spring 2026 tour is presented in co-production with Theatre Centre, Sheffield Theatres and National Youth Theatre. Originally seed commissioned by the National Youth Theatre (NYT), My Brother's a Genius has been commissioned for full production by Theatre Centre and further developed through our acclaimed Future Makers process.

Debris has worked with young people, NYT members and educators in schools across England to ensure the world of the play is rooted in the world of young people today.

The development of My Brother’s a Genius has been generously supported by Creative Crawley and Stanley Arts London.
